850965075 has 48 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 1573932000. Its totient is φ = 450748800.
The previous prime is 850965061. The next prime is 850965077. The reversal of 850965075 is 570569058.
850965075 is a `hidden beast` number, since 8 + 50 + 96 + 507 + 5 = 666.
850965075 is digitally balanced in base 2, because in such base it contains all the possibile digits an equal number of times.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 850965075 - 25 = 850965043 is a prime.
It is a Harshad number since it is a multiple of its sum of digits (45).
It is a self number, because there is not a number n which added to its sum of digits gives 850965075.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(850965077)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 47 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 96345 + ... + 104805.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(32790250).
Almost surely, 2850965075 is an apocalyptic number.
850965075 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(722966925).
850965075 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
850965075 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 8629 (or 8618 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 378000, while the sum is 45.
The square root of 850965075 is about 29171.3056786973. The cubic root of 850965075 is about 947.6266054718.
The spelling of 850965075 in words is "eight hundred fifty million, nine hundred sixty-five thousand, seventy-five".
